Published - Monday, May 19, 2008 Separate motorcycle crashes result in two deaths A La Crosse man was killed in a motorcycle accident in Crawford County and an Iron Mountain, Mich., man was killed in a motorcycle accident in Vernon County, both on Saturday. William R. Norman, 60, La Crosse, was westbound on Hwy. 82 in Freeman Township, according to the Crawford County Sheriff’s Department. He was passing a vehicle on the left when he lost control of his motorcycle at 3:51 p.m. The motorcycle slid 320 feet. Norman was ejected from the cycle. He was pronounced dead at the scene by Crawford County Coroner Joe Morovits. Dale Wahlstrom, 65, Iron Mountain, Mich., was operating a motorcycle westbound on Hwy. 33 when he lost control negotiating a curve at 10:56 a.m., according to the Vernon County Sheriff’s Department. Wahlstrom’s motorcycle slid into the eastbound lane and struck an oncoming vehicle driven by Daniel Coggon, 27, La Farge. Coggon and a passenger in his vehicle were uninjured. Wahlstrom was taken to St. Joseph’s Hospital in Hillsboro by the Ontario Ambulance. He was pronounced dead at the hospital. Both accidents are still under investigation. Wahlstrom’s death marks the third motor vehicle fatality in Vernon County in 2008.
